Save
Touhou Project Umbrella Team Shanghai Alice Radika Rain PNG, Clipart,  Free PNG Download
This PNG image was uploaded on October 24, 2024, 1:24 pm by user: fgsduhfgbusd and is about . It has a resolution of 512x512 pixels.
Free Download (141.37 KB)

Touhou Project Umbrella Team Shanghai Alice Radika Rain PNG

Edit PNG
AI Background Remover
512x512
141.37 KB
October 24, 2024
PNG (300 DPI)